    Default setting transition for multiple clips in sony vegas?

    My 1 hr recording session is captured into 50 m2t files onto computer. I put them on the timeline of Sony Vegas. Now, I want to put transition and fade in/out between each clips in Sony Vega.

    Is there any way to do it automatically? Let say I want to set 5 secs fade-in and 5 secs fade-out and the same transition for all 50 clips. Is there anyway to do it?

    So far, I have to set manually each fade in/out and transition. For 50 clips, it is a time-taking task.

    Im a little confused on the question. You want to put a fade in and fade out on each clip - but also a transition? Wouldn't the fade in and fade out be your transition? Anyway - I think you can set in preferences how you want multiple clips to be loaded. I don't know if it works with 'fade-in' fade out - but it does with over-lapping. I do a lot of photo (slide show) type stuff and load about 50 pics in at a time with automatice overlaping (disolve) set to 6 sec in preferences.
